It was narrated that Abu Hurairah (Rali) said: “The Messenger of Allah said:
‘There has come to you Ramadhaan, a blessed month, in which Almighty Allah has enjoined you to (observe) fast. In it the gates of Heavens are opened and the gates of Hell are closed and every Devil is chained up. In it Allah has a night which is better than a thousand months; whoever is deprived of its goodness is indeed deprived.”‘
